How much does it cost to move from Oklahoma City to Anchorage?

Expect moving costs from Oklahoma City to Anchorage to vary based on the size of your move. Small moves typically range from $1,936 to $2,080, medium moves from $2,226 to $2,392, and large moves from $2,517 to $2,704. Price differences arise due to shipment volume, packing needs, and additional services like storage or expedited delivery. Longer distances and specialized handling for Alaska-bound shipments also influence overall costs.

How We Calculate These Estimates

The city pairs shown on this page are drawn from the interstate moving routes most frequently searched and requested through Price Movers between these two states. Distances shown are calculated as the straight-line (geodesic) distance between representative locations in each city, not the actual driving distance. Your real driving distance and route will depend on your exact pickup and delivery addresses. Cost ranges are estimates based on typical pricing reported for moves of comparable distance and home size on this route. They do not include optional services such as packing, storage, or specialty item handling, and are not a quote — your final price depends on your inventory, exact addresses, and the mover you choose. Movers shown on this page are companies in our directory that report serving the origin or destination area of this route. Inclusion is not an endorsement; always verify a mover’s licensing and insurance before booking. Are movers from Oklahoma City to Anchorage required to have interstate licenses?

Yes, moving companies operating between states must hold valid interstate licenses to comply with federal regulations, ensuring professional and legal service.

Do I need storage for this route?
If your new home isn’t ready when your belongings arrive, most interstate movers offer short-term storage-in-transit as part of, or in addition to, your move. Confirm storage costs and any time limits before you book.
